* * * * * ON AN INFANT WHICH DIED BEFORE BAPTISM. "Be, rather than be called, a child of God," Death whispered!--with assenting nod, Its head upon its mother's breast, The baby bowed, without demur-- Of the kingdom of the Blest Possessor, not inheritor.
